XK7 on Crayn luoma supertietokonealusta , joka tuotiin markkinoille 29. lokakuuta 2012. XK7 on Crayn toinen alusta Cray XK6:n jälkeen, jossa GPU:ita käytetään tietojenkäsittelyyn prosessorien ohella . Tämä hybridiarkkitehtuuri vaatii erilaista ohjelmointitapaa kuin perinteinen lähestymistapa, jossa ohjelmoidaan vain prosessorit. XK7:n ostaneet laboratoriot järjestävät työpajoja kouluttaakseen tutkijoita tähän uuteen lähestymistapaan, jotta he voivat rakentaa sovelluksia XK7:lle.
XK7-alustaa käytetään Titan -supertietokoneessa , joka on toiseksi tehokkain supertietokone marraskuussa 2014 [1] Top500 - luokituksen mukaan . Muita alustan ostajia ovat Swiss National Supercomputing Center, jossa on 272-solmun kone, ja National Center for Supercomputing Applications Yhdysvalloissa, jonka Blue Waters -supertietokone on yhdistelmä Cray XE6- ja Cray XK7 -alustan solmuja ja jolla on prosessointiteho noin 1 petaflops [2] .
XK7 skaalaa jopa 500 telineeseen. Jokaisessa telineessä on 24 korttia, joista jokaisessa on 4 laskentasolmua (jossakin solmussa on 1 CPU ja 1 GPU) [3] . AMD Opteron 6200 Interlagos 16-ytiminen prosessoreita käytetään keskusprosessoreina ja Nvidia Tesla K20 Kepler -sarjan kortteja käytetään näytönohjainkortteina . Jokainen CPU on varustettu joko 16 tai 32 Gt virheenkorjausmuistilla ja GPU on varustettu 5 tai 6 Gt RAM-muistilla käytetystä mallista riippuen. Supertietokoneen solmut kommunikoivat keskenään nopean Gemini Interconnect -verkon kautta. Jokainen Gemini-siru palvelee 2 solmua ja sen suorituskyky on 160 Gt/s. Käytettyjen komponenttien mukaan yksi teline täynnä teriä voi kuluttaa 45-54,1 kW sähköä muutettuna lämmöksi. Telineitä jäähdytetään siksi joko ilma- tai vesijäähdytyksellä.
XK7-supertietokoneet käyttävät Cray Linux Environment -käyttöympäristöä , joka sisältää SUSE Linux Enterprise Server -käyttöjärjestelmän . Ohjelmat XK7:lle voidaan kirjoittaa eri kielillä, mutta alustan hybridiarkkitehtuuri vaatii erityistä ohjelmointitapaa. Okrizhdin kansallinen laboratorio ja Sveitsin kansallinen supertietokonekeskus järjestävät seminaareja, joiden tarkoituksena on kouluttaa tutkijoita XK7-alustan ohjelmoinnin ominaisuuksista [5] . [6]
Alusta tuotiin markkinoille 29. lokakuuta 2012, samaan aikaan kun Titan -supertietokone lanseerattiin virallisesti Oak Ridge National Laboratoryssa . Titan koostuu 18688 XK7-alustasolmusta, joista jokaisessa on Opteron 6274 -suoritin 32 Gt RAM-muistilla ja K20X-näytönohjain, jossa on 6 Gt RAM-muistia. Supertietokoneen teoreettinen suorituskyky on 27,1 Petaflopsia, mutta TOP500-luokitukseen käytetyssä LINPACK- testissä tietokone osoitti tulokseksi 17,59 Petaflopsia, mikä riitti ykkössijalle marraskuun 2012 listalla. Titan kuluttaa 8,2 MW sähköä ja on kolmanneksi tehokkain Green500 .
Yhdysvaltain kansallisella supertietokonesovelluskeskuksella on Blue Waters -supertietokone , joka on yhdistelmä 22 752 Cray XE6 -solmua ja 3 072 Cray XK7 -solmua. Jokaisessa XE6-solmussa on kaksi Opteron 6276 -suoritinta ja 32 Gt RAM-muistia. XK7-solmut käyttävät yhtä Opteron 6276 -suoritinta 32 Gt:lla ja yhtä K20X GPU:ta, jossa on 6 Gt RAM-muistia. Vertailuarvoissa Blue Waters osoitti 1 Peftaflopsin suorituskykyä, kun taas Blue Watersin projektipäälliköt eivät usko LINPACK-testin merkitykseen eivätkä sen vuoksi suorittaneet tätä vertailuarvoa supertietokoneessaan.
Sveitsin kansallinen supertietokonekeskus päivitti Todi -supertietokoneensa XK7-alustaksi 22. lokakuuta 2012 [7] . Todi koostuu 272 solmusta, joissa on Opteron 6272 -suoritin ja 32 Gt RAM-muistia, sekä K20X- näytönohjain, jossa on 6 Gt RAM-muistia [8] . Todin teoreettinen laskentateho on 393 teraflopsia, mutta marraskuun 2013 TOP500-luokituksessa se on 139. sijalla 273,7 teraflopsia [9] . Todi kuluttaa 122 kW sähköä ja on 36. sijalla Green500 marraskuussa 2013 [10]
Cray kehitys | ||
---|---|---|
Cray tutkimus | ||
Cray Computer Corp. |
| |
Cray Research -superpalvelimet |
| |
Cray Inc. |
| |
Ohjelmisto |
|